Mental Health Services | Northeastern Mental Health Center
Offers outpatient counseling services for individual, couple, and families. Staff members work with the client to provide services in the home, community, or office at the discretion of the client. Substance use evaluation, assessment, and treatment is also provided. Walk in assessments and telehealth services are available during normal business hours at the Aberdeen location. Psychiatric services are also available to those over the age of 18 including assessments and medication management.

Crisis Counseling and Play Therapy Services | Solace
Assisting survivors of sexual, relational, and family trauma through the healing process, by serving survivors of all genders, beginning at age 3.
Services include:
individual or group therapy for children, teens, and adults, with a licensed therapist or graduate-level therapy intern under supervision of a licensed therapist (includes brainspotting)
counseling services for caregivers of children or other secondary survivors of those affected by sexual, relational, and/or family trauma
parent-child interaction therapy, a therapy for non-offending caregiver and child
play therapy for children ages 3-12 who are primary or secondary survivors of sexual, relational, and family trauma
crisis counseling - walk-in therapeutic support that provides stabilization through coping skills and resource identification
